Developed by Josh Wardle, Wordle has grown significantly since its initial launch. Each guess provides feedback through colored tiles: green indicates the correct letter in the correct position, yellow signals a correct letter in the wrong position, and gray means the letter is not in the word. This clever system of hints makes each game a blend of logic and vocabulary.

Wordle is accessible via the New York Times website, where players can enjoy the game for free. However, to save statistics and access deeper analysis, a New York Times Games subscription is required. This accessibility, combined with the game’s daily challenge, keeps players engaged and coming back for more.
In recent years, Wordle has inspired numerous spin-offs and variations, from music identification games like Heardle to multi-word challenges such as Dordle and Quordle. These adaptations demonstrate the game’s influence and the creativity it has sparked among fans.
